The Exhausted Generation

from The Cellular Alchemist · host Ritu Malhotra - Spiritual Psychologist

Everywhere I look, I see tired faces. Not just physically tired, but soul-tired.In this episode, I share Tanya’s story. A young professional who feels stuck, uninspired, and disconnected from her own life. We talk about why exhaustion has become the default state for so many of us, how constant comparison and social media amplify our sense of inadequacy, and what it really means to live a human-needs-first life.Tune in, and maybe let this be the gentle nudge you needed to start making space for yourself again✨
